Abstract
An example circuit board includes a plurality of dielectric layers having a plurality of pattern holes; and a plurality of transmission lines formed in the plurality of dielectric layers, and coupled according to the plurality of pattern holes so as to form a plurality of patterns, wherein, when a current is applied to each of the plurality of transmission lines, magnetic flux can be generated in the plurality of patterns.
